RV Pads in Eagle, Idaho: How to Build a Long-Lasting Concrete Pad That Handles Weight, Weather, and Time

A clean, level parking pad is more than curb appeal—it protects your RV and your property. In Eagle and the greater Treasure Valley, an RV pad needs to do two jobs at once: carry substantial loads and survive freeze/thaw cycles. Concrete Driveways in Caldwell, Idaho: How to Build for Freeze-Thaw, Heat, and Heavy Use

A driveway that looks great today—and still performs years from now—starts with the right plan. In Caldwell and the greater Treasure Valley, a concrete driveway needs to handle hot, dry summers and winter temperature swings that can push moisture into the slab and stress the surface during freeze-thaw cycles.
